mysql数据库是很多小伙伴都在使用的一个关系型数据库,但是最近有小伙伴说在执行mysql命令是无论是什么都会出现段错误这个问题。那么下面这篇文章就要来详细的分析一下这个问题的原因并解决它,往下看看吧。
一、段错误原因
段错误其实就是core dumped,也就是内存丢弃的意思。出现这个问题的原因一般来说就是因为程序运行时出现了问题,从而导致cpu无法在继续处理只能将程序当成垃圾给丢掉的意思。
可以在命令行处在重新执行一下mysql的命令,然后在报错的提示之中可以找到是哪里的程序出现错误而导致了这个问题,很大的可能版本冲突或者是启动路径的问题。
二、解决方法
1.在服务处启动mysql服务,然后在开始菜单处搜索命令行并点击搜索出来的程序命令行提示符将其打开。打开后在光标处输入which mysql来查看当前的启动路径是什么,如果和自己mysql的安装路径不符应该就是在安装包或者库的时候用别的路径将其改变了。
2.启动路径被更改了的话还可以使用cp命令来将原本的启动路径覆盖这个错误的启动路径,在命令行输入下面的这个命令就可以了,如下所示:
cp -ar /usr/local/mysql/bin/* /usr/bin/
这上面的路径要换成自己的mysql安装路径和刚刚查出来的启动路径。
以上就是关于“MySQL数据库提示段错误怎么办?MySQL段错误解决方法是什么”的全部内容了,想要了解更多python的实用知识和代码示例可以在网页顶部栏目中找到python查看更多哦。